[wdmaudiodev] Re: virtual audio driver removed via devcon, but it's only hidden

  • From: "Vincent Burel \(VB-Audio\)" <vincent.burel@xxxxxxxxxxxx>
  • To: <wdmaudiodev@xxxxxxxxxxxxx>
  • Date: Sat, 13 Oct 2018 09:14:52 +0200

Hello,

 

The problem is there since WIN7 and it seems the reboot is finalizing the
uninstallation (this is the only way we found to be sure about the audio
driver de-installation) .

…with WIN10 there is additional problems regarding driver
installation/de-installation, especially re-installation (used by WIN10
automatic update).

 

Also devcon.exe seems to be bugged and can install 2 instances of your audio
driver, the instance will be marked as disabled, but de-installation won’t
be clear anyway if you don’t de-install manually the disabled occurrence of
your driver…

 

Microsoft does not care about this and the only reply will get is “please
post a request in feedback hub”

 

Regards

Vincent Burel

 

De : wdmaudiodev-bounce@xxxxxxxxxxxxx
[mailto:wdmaudiodev-bounce@xxxxxxxxxxxxx] De la part de Johannes Freyberger
Envoyé : samedi 13 octobre 2018 08:37
À : wdmaudiodev@xxxxxxxxxxxxx
Objet : [wdmaudiodev] virtual audio driver removed via devcon, but it's only
hidden

 

Hi all,

 

when I’m uninstalling my pure virtual audio driver on some W10, 1803
machines via devcon remove the driver the driver doesn’t seem to be
uninstalled completely as it is still visible as hidden device in the device
manager even after a reboot. But in setupapi.dev.log the corresponding entry
says:

 

 [Delete Device - ROOT\MEDIA\0006]

 Section start 2018/10/12 09:52:11.354

      cmd: "C:\Program Files (x86)\MyApplication\devcon.exe" remove
*MyDriver

     dvi: Query-and-Remove succeeded

<<<  Section end 2018/10/12 09:52:12.031

<<<  [Exit status: SUCCESS]

 

On some other machines the drivers are completely gone and not in hidden
state.

 

Could this “hidden driver” effect be due to user privileges or some Antivir
software installed on these machines? 

What makes an uninstalled driver go into this hidden state and can this have
any subsequent negative effects if I’m installing a new version of my driver
while the old version is still in this hidden state? 

Could this be something which is new since the 1803 update as I don’t think
I’ve seen this before?

 

Thanks and best regards,

Johannes Freyberger

 

Other related posts: